Support-A-Creator Program
The Sims Creators on ea.comThe challenge
Across the industry, gaming publishers and creator networks were shifting from measuring creators' influence in impressions to connecting it to actual purchases. EA's Creator Network needed a model that made that shift: turning creator relationships into a measurable, scalable revenue channel rather than one-off activations with tricky-to-measure ROI.
The approach
- Positioned the Creator Network's structure and value proposition for creators and EA franchises alike.
- Built direct tracking of revenue driven alongside improved tracking of content produced, giving a holistic view of the value of every creator activation.
- Shifted from one-off activations to longer-term relationships with all creators, diversifying incentive structures to keep them engaged for longer.
- Created regular, consistent touchpoints with creators, and through them a path to new audiences.
- Launched the Support-A-Creator program with The Sims as the pilot title.

What creators need
Create remarkable content
Creators need empowerment through our games and experiences to easily create high-quality UGC.

Grow a community audience
Creators need avenues to promote and grow their reach in order to develop community on platforms.
Own their diversified audience
Creators need to expand their footprint across dozens of other ecosystem channels.
Monetise their audience
Creators want authentic and seamless ways to monetize their audiences, both in and out of games. With Support-A-Creator, a creator's code at checkout supports them directly, at no extra cost to their fans.

Connect with community offline
Creators seek physical and experiential ways, beyond content, to connect offline with their community and tribe of superfans.
Manage their business to drive growth
Creators need to understand how their content and creations are performing, from both engagement and monetization perspectives.

“Provide creators with the ability and freedom to generate their own revenue in a way that feels organic and genuine to their community.”— The program's goal
